Résidence Odalys Collection Mendi Alde stands on land shaped by centuries of pastoral tradition, Savoyard heritage, and the slow transformation of La Clusaz from a remote mountain hamlet into a thriving, year-round Alpine village.
Before residences and ski lifts defined the landscape, the area beneath the modern property was deeply connected to agricultural rhythms that sustained generations of mountain families. Herds of cattle and goats grazed the meadows surrounding this slope, producing the milk that became Reblochon, among the region's most iconic cheeses. Wooden barns, storage chalets, and small homesteads once dotted the terrain, each tied to families who lived simply and seasonally in harmony with the mountains. La Clusaz's origins date back to the 12th century, when the village grew around its historic church and scattered wooden chalets. The land where Résidence Odalys Collection Mendi Alde now stands would have been part of the village's outer pastoral zone, used for hay harvesting, livestock care, and footpaths connecting seasonal grazing areas. The narrow geographic “cluse”, the passage from which the village derives its name, shaped early settlement patterns. During the Middle Ages, harsh winters often isolated the community for months at a time. The land beneath the future residence was used for essential survival work: stacking hay, storing tools, keeping herds sheltered, and preparing for winter. Daily life was governed by the cycles of agriculture and the ebb and flow of mountain seasons. By the 19th century, the Alps began attracting explorers, naturalists, and early tourists fascinated by dramatic landscapes and rural life. As interest in mountain air and scenic beauty increased, La Clusaz slowly opened itself to outside visitors. The land near the present-day residence began transitioning from purely agricultural use to part of a growing village infrastructure. The early 20th century introduced the most dramatic shift: skiing. When La Clusaz installed its first mechanical lifts and embraced winter sports, the entire village transformed. Pastureland gave way to ski routes, chalets became lodges, and the demand for accommodations increased. The terrain that would one day hold Résidence Odalys Collection Mendi Alde became strategically valuable thanks to its proximity to the slopes and its gentle elevation. As resort tourism expanded in the mid-1900s, the area saw gradual development aligned with the needs of modern travelers while still respecting the region's architectural traditions.
